Small dual-purpose satellites are emerging as viable contenders for both military and civil surveillance applications. The cost-effective and highly survivable small satellites are stimulating real time information systems concepts for use by local tactical commanders in a variety of threat scenarios. The small spacecraft, with significant technical commonalities, also could offer continuous, close coverage over the whole Earth for agriculture, pollution and meteorology observations. The Strategic Defense Initiative is seeking to add defense to the reconnaissance and observation satellite missions performed in space. This is leading to the development of tiny but capable space-based brilliant pebbles single hit-to-kill interceptors, with masses of 30 to 40 kg.
